java怎么编程随机三位数的数据

在Java编程中,生成随机三位数的数据是一个常见的需求,无论是用于测试还是实际应用。以下是一些简单的步骤和代码示例,帮助你轻松实现这一功能。
一、理解需求
我们需要明确我们的目标:生成一个随机三位数。这意味着这个数应该在100到999之间。
二、使用Java内置库
Java提供了丰富的内置库来帮助我们生成随机数。我们可以使用java.util.Random类来实现这一需求。
三、编写代码
下面是一个简单的Java代码示例,展示如何生成一个随机三位数:
importjava.util.RandompublicclassRandomThreeDigitNumber{
publicstaticvoidmain(String[]args){
Randomrandom=newRandom()
intrandomNumber=random.nextInt(900)+100
/生成100到999之间的随机数
System.out.println("生成的随机三位数是:"+randomNumber)
1.导入java.util.Random类。
2.创建Random对象。
3.使用nextInt(900)生成一个0到899之间的随机数。
4.将这个随机数加上100,得到一个100到999之间的随机数。
5.打印出生成的随机数。
四、优化代码
在实际应用中,我们可能需要生成多个随机三位数。为了提高效率,我们可以将生成随机数的逻辑封装成一个方法。
publicclassRandomThreeDigitNumber{publicstaticvoidmain(String[]args){
for(inti=0
i++){//生成5个随机三位数
System.out.println("生成的随机三位数是:"+generateRandomThreeDigitNumber())
privatestaticintgenerateRandomThreeDigitNumber(){
Randomrandom=newRandom()
returnrandom.nextInt(900)+100
在这个改进的版本中,我们添加了一个generateRandomThreeDigitNumber方法,它返回一个随机三位数。在main方法中,我们循环调用这个方法来生成多个随机数。
五、
通过以上步骤,我们可以轻松地在Java中生成随机三位数。这不仅可以帮助我们在编程中测试随机性,还可以在游戏、抽奖等场景中应用。希望这篇文章能帮助你解决实际问题,提高编程技能。
本文地址:
http://www.kazuhiromimori.com/news/artf2618bc.html
发布于 2025-12-16 18:32:16
文章转载或复制请以
超链接形式
并注明出处
三森网
